AGZLCSABZ.23 RESIDENCE, VALUABLE SUBURBAN PROPERTY, By order of the Mortgagee.
CONNELL <0 RIDINGS'
Will Sell by Public Auction, at their Mart, Queen-street, on Saturday, 24th instant, at 12 o'clock, HP HAT Commodious and Elegantly finished JL Suburban Villa
" Collin Hill Bouse,"
situate on the road leading to George's Bay, now in the occupation of W. Plummer, Esq., together with nearly Two Acres of Ground, all cultivated and laid down in grass, and well enclosed. The House consists of three floors, the lowest containing a Bricked Kitchen, Cellar, Servants' Room, &c The Second — Two Sittingrooms, 13 and 15 feet by 12, two £ed-rooms, Closets, &c. ; and the Third —Two Large Attics. There is an excellent Two-stall Stable, and other Outhouses, and bricked Well constantly supplied with good water. Also — " Collik Hill Cottage," Now in the occupation of Mr. Forsyth, rind adjoining the foregoing property. The Cottage consists of four comfortable rooms, 12 by 14, with hall, Verandah, &c, substantially built and well finished. A capacious Outbuilding, heretofore used as a Storehouse and Workshop, could be readily
adapted as a Roomy Stable and Loft 1 . An excellent Bricked Well on the Premises. The Ground consists of nearly Two Acres ol excellent laud, cultivated and laid down in grass, and well enclosed with live fence. Terms at Sale.
BY ORDER OF THE MORTGAGEE.
CONNELL §f RIDINGS Will Sell by Auction, at iheir Mart, Queenstieet, on Saturday, the 24th July instant, at 12 o'clock, unless previously disposed of by Private Contract, ALL that Allotment or Parcel of Land containing by admeasurement 112 acres, situate in the Parish of Manurewa, County of Eden, and being No. 14 of Manurewa Farms ; bounded on the North by No. 13, 5240 links and 310 links; on the Noith-East, by the road from Otahuhu to Papaiewia, 1200 links; on the SSouth-East by Crown land, 1 800 links; on the South by Crown 1and, 4871 links; and on the West by the Tamaki River. This very desirable Farm is situated on the Grkat South Road, at a short distance beyond the New Bridge over the Tamaki. The land is of superior t&ual ty, and possesses the impoitant advantage of easy access to Market both by land and water, having extensive frontage to the River Tamaki, and to the above thoroughfare. Terms Liberal.
